Fire officials investigating poultry house fire in Dorchester Co.

HURLOCK, Md. – Maryland State Fire Marshals are investigating an early morning poultry house fire in Hurlock.

Officials say the blaze was reported at around 7:15 a.m., at 6743 East New Market Ellwood Road. 80 firefighters responded to the two alarm fire, which took nearly two hours to control.

Heavy fire damage has been estimated at $335,000. The cause and origin of this fire remains under investigation.
